优化网站字体加载速度的方法有很多,选择适当的字体格式很关键,例如使用WOFF2、WOFF或EOT格式以减少文件大小,合并和压缩字体文件,以降低HTTP请求次数和文件尺寸,还可以将小字体嵌入到CSS中,以加快首次渲染速度,利用浏览器缓存,设置合理的字体加载策略,如预加载关键字体,对于非关键字体则采用延迟加载,可以有效提升网站的加载速度。
在数字时代,网站的速度和用户体验至关重要,特别是在网页中,字体加载速度不仅影响阅读体验,还关系到网站的整体性能,字体是网页设计中的重要元素,它们能够提升文本的可读性和美观性,如果字体文件过大或者加载过慢,就会对用户造成不便,如何优化网站的字体加载速度呢?下面是一些具体的建议。
选择合适的字体格式
字体的格式多种多样,但并不是所有的格式都适合在线使用,WOFF和WOFF2格式的字体文件大小较小,加载速度快,适合在线使用,而TTF和OTF格式的字体文件较大,加载速度较慢,在选择字体格式时,应优先考虑WOFF和WOFF2格式。
压缩字体文件
字体文件过大是影响字体加载速度的一个重要因素,为了减小字体文件的大小,可以对字体文件进行压缩,常用的压缩工具有CSS Compress和字体工具(如FontForge),通过压缩字体文件,可以显著减小文件大小,从而加快加载速度。
使用浏览器缓存
浏览器缓存是一种提高网站性能的有效方法,通过设置合理的缓存策略,可以让用户在多次访问网站时,不需要重复下载已经加载过的字体文件,这不仅可以减少网络流量消耗,还可以提高网站的响应速度,在服务器端配置缓存策略时,可以根据用户的网络环境和设备类型,设定不同的缓存时间和过期时间。
异步加载字体
异步加载字体可以避免字体加载对网页渲染造成阻塞,通过在HTML文件的头部(head)中插入<link>标签,并设置rel="preload"属性,可以让浏览器在解析HTML文档的同时,预加载字体文件,这样,当页面开始渲染时,字体文件已经下载并准备好了,从而提高字体加载速度。
优化网络环境
优化网络环境也是提高字体加载速度的一个重要措施,通过使用CDN(内容分发网络)可以将字体文件分发到离用户更近的服务器上,从而减少网络传输时间和延迟,还可以通过优化服务器响应时间、减少HTTP请求次数等方式来提高网站的整体性能。
考虑使用系统字体
如果网站的字体需求不是特别复杂,可以考虑使用系统字体,系统字体不需要额外的文件下载和解析过程,因此可以大大提高网站的加载速度,在使用系统字体时,要注意保持设计的一致性和美观性。
优化网站的字体加载速度需要从多个方面入手,包括选择合适的字体格式、压缩字体文件、使用浏览器缓存、异步加载字体、优化网络环境以及考虑使用系统字体等,通过综合运用这些方法,可以显著提高网站的性能和用户体验。


还没有评论,来说两句吧...